D-Type Leads Parade of Jaguars at 2014 Goodwood Revival

By Paul Joseph

Jaguar will have a major presence at the sell-out 2014 Goodwood Revival which kicks off this week, with the Lightweight E-type making its European debut and the new F-TYPE Project 7 also being showcased.

The 60th anniversary of the legendary Jaguar D-type will be marked in style at this year’s Goodwood show. To mark the occasion, the Lavant Cup race will be dedicated to the D-type with more than 20 examples of this legendary competition Jaguar competing.

Ex-Jaguar Le Mans winner Andy Wallace will participate in a 1955 ‘long-nose’ D-type alongside other familiar faces, including fellow ex-Le Mans winner Derek Bell.

On Revival Friday and Sunday, a spirited parade of D-types will take place around the Goodwood circuit, with a record number of examples of the racing Jaguar gathered in one place.

Following its recent unveiling at Pebble Beach in California, where it wowed spectators, the Lightweight E-type continuation model will make its much-anticipated European debut, while the new F-TYPE Project 7 by Jaguar Land Rover Special Operations will also be on display along with the stunning Jaguar F-TYPE R Coupé.

In addition, another 25 or so Jaguars and Jaguar-powered cars will be competing wheel-to-wheel at the unspoiled Goodwood motor circuit, with racing C-types and E-types, plus Mark I and Mark VII saloons out in force.
